You might think the the CPUs and ICs that drive the computer world are good models of deterministic precision........Guess again!

Their behaviour is inherently unpredictable and chaotic. Intel's Pentium 4 CPU core has 42 Million transistors and the newer Itanium 2 has no less than 410 million of them!.
Hugues Berry of the National Reasearch Institute for Information and Automation based in France, says "Their performance can be highly variable and difficult to predict" The team from the research institute ran a standard program repeatedly on a simulator which engineers use to test microprocessors, they found that the time it took to complete the task varied greatly from one run to the next.

Within the irregularity, the team discovered a pattern, that of the mathematical signature of "deterministic chaos", a property that governs other chaotic systems, such as the weather.
Such systems are extremely sensitive to small changes, a change at one point can lead to much wider fluctuations at a later time. For the microprocessor, this means that the precise course of a computation and the length of time taken, is sensitive to the processor's state when the computation began.

Here is the website for the research paper: (warning, heavy reading)

http://arxiv.org/abs/nlin.AO/0506030
